Children's shoe shop closing down

A children's shoe and accessories boutique is the latest Wilmslow shop to announce its closure, after 15 months of trading in the town centre.

Wilmslow resident Andi Lee opened Tiny Soles on Grove Street in December 2012. Yesterday he posted a message on Facebook saying "It's with great sadness that we are to announce Tiny Soles is closing down. We have a massive closing down sale starting tomorrow at 10am.

"We would like to thank all our loyal customers for supporting us whilst we have been trading. We hope you will pop in, if not for a bargain then at least to say goodbye."

Andi told wilmslow.co.uk "We are not closing for financial reasons but because we have had issues with the landlord over problems with the premises and he wasn't willing to negotiate."

There have been a number of changes in Wilmslow this year with the closure of Yogberries, Hullabaloo Toys, Margarita Lounge, Claires', Shalimar Indian Restaurant, Ten Little Monkeys and Lucy's with Love. Jane Shilton is also preparing to close after decades of trading in the town.

Whilst new additions include The Sweet Shop which opened on Parsonage Green this week. Next week Barkers, a brand new shop exclusively for dogs, will open in the former Blockbusters store on Alderley Road and The Old Dancer will open on Grove Street.

Also, as announced on wilmslow.co.uk yesterday, tearooms and a 1920s bar have been granted planning permission and plan to open in the former Simon Dunn shop in the summer.
